British sixth formers, Australian Science Scholars
Jul. 07, 1968 - Royal Institution Australian Science Scholars: The five outstanding sixth-formers who have been selected to attend the International Science School for High School Students in Sydney, from 26 August to September 6 this year - were this afternoon at the Royal Institution. The International Science School is sponsored by the Science foundation for Physics within the University of Sydney, under the Directorship of Professor Harry Messel. Its programme will include 20 lectures by distinguished scientists from from all over the world, on the general theme of Man in Inner and Outer Space'. 20 overseas scholarships have been awarded: to five British students, five from Japan and ten from the United States. The scholarship entitles their winners to a round-the-world air ticket including two-week stay in Sydney for the Science School. This is the first year that British scholars will attend the School, but it is intended to continue this arrangement in future years. The five British sixth-formers were selected by a joint committee of the Royal Institution of Gt. Britain and the Association for Science Education. The five British scholars are: Anne Theresa Stimson, 18, of Chingford, Essex, who attends St. Mary's Grammar School, Woodford Green; Lina Talbot, who is nearly 17, of Newton Abbot, Devon, who attend Torquay Girl Grammar School; Ralph Andrews, nearly 17, from Heston, Middx, who is at Malvern College, Worcs; Jonathan Foreman, 17, from Ware, Herts, who attends Broxbourne Grammar School, Herts, and Richard Shuttleworth, nearly 17, from Croydon, Surrey, who attends Dulwich College.
